The TOGAF Business Architecture Level 1 credential validates that you understand the key business-architecture techniques of the TOGAF Standard, Version 9.2 - business modeling, business capabilities, value streams, information mapping and TOGAF business scenarios - and how to apply them in developing a business architecture. It is earned by passing the OGB-001 exam and leads to an Open Badge. This is the Version 9.2 business-architecture credential. It is different from the TOGAF Business Architecture Foundation (OGBA-101), which is based on the 10th Edition and has 40 questions; The Open Group supports both, so check which version you need. If your employer or goal specifies the 9.2 credential, this is the right course. The exam is 30 simple multiple-choice questions in 45 minutes, closed book, with each question worth one point; you pass with 60% (18 of 30). There is no prerequisite. The certification does not expire: it is tied to the Version 9.2 Body of Knowledge and has no renewal requirement.

Exam details verified on 17 August 2026. The OGB-001 exam is 30 multiple-choice questions in 45 minutes, closed book, based on the TOGAF Standard, Version 9.2, with a 60% pass mark (18 of 30). There is no prerequisite; passing awards the TOGAF Business Architecture Level 1 credential and an Open Badge. The certification does not expire. Exam fees vary by region.
